At The Edge Of The Orchard by Tracey Chevalier. Review


This is the story about the Goodenough family who live in the black swamp. The mother and father have no real respect for each  other and their children see this. When their rage reaches its pinnacle one day ,one of their children , Robert , goes in search of a better life far away from this dismal and depressing place leaving all his family behind. 
We catch up with him through the years with letters he writes to his family as he continues his adventures. 
The story is beautiful and tragic , truly grim at times , but Robert is risiliant and does not let all the bad things in life keep him down. The story was definetly a journey with Robert , through years and people he meets and it made great reading .
